The Paths and the Beginning of the End

When we talk about the Letzter Moment der Titan, it's crucial to understand the role of the Paths. This mystical, ethereal realm is where the Eldian race's memories and consciousness converge, and it's where Ymir Fritz, the original Titan, has been waiting for millennia. Eren Yeager's decision to embrace the Founding Titan's power and initiate the Rumbling fundamentally altered the course of history, aiming to achieve his definition of freedom by eradicating humanity outside of Paradis Island. The Letzter Moment der Titan didn't just happen in the physical world; it began in the Paths, with Eren's complex motivations and his ultimate confrontation with his own fate. The manipulation of Titans, the rallying of the corrupted Eldians, and the sheer scale of the destruction unleashed were all orchestrated from this central nexus. The Paths served as the ultimate battlefield for ideological and existential conflict, where the past, present, and future of Eldians intertwined. Eren's journey within the Paths is a fascinating, albeit disturbing, exploration of determinism versus free will. He sees all possible futures, all the pain and suffering that will inevitably occur, and yet he chooses this path. The Letzter Moment der Titan becomes less about a singular event and more about the culmination of Eren's long, agonizing plan. It’s here that we see the true cost of his quest for freedom, not just for himself, but for everyone connected to the Eldian bloodline. The whispers of Ymir, the manipulation of Zeke, and Eren's own internal turmoil all play out in this surreal landscape, setting the stage for the final showdown. The sheer scope of the Rumbling, with billions of Colossal Titans marching forward, is a terrifying spectacle that underscores the Letzter Moment der Titan as a pivotal, world-altering event. It forces the remaining Survey Corps members and Marleyan soldiers to band together, their animosities forgotten in the face of a common, existential threat. This unity, forged in the fires of desperation, is a testament to the series' evolving themes of breaking cycles of hatred and finding common ground, even in the darkest of times. The Letzter Moment der Titan is not just a physical end, but a profound philosophical one, forcing characters and viewers alike to question the very nature of good and evil, and the true meaning of freedom.

Mikasa's Crucial Role and the True End of the Titans

The ultimate act that brings about the Letzter Moment der Titan falls upon the shoulders of Mikasa Ackerman. Throughout the series, Mikasa's unwavering devotion to Eren has been a central theme. However, as Eren's actions become more extreme and destructive, she is faced with an agonizing decision: to save the world or to save the person she loves most. This internal conflict is the emotional core of the finale. The final confrontation takes place in the mouth of Eren's Colossal Titan form, a symbolic and incredibly poignant setting. It is here that Mikasa must make the hardest choice of her life, a choice that will determine the fate of humanity and the end of the Titans forever. The Letzter Moment der Titan is ultimately about breaking the cycle of hatred and the curse of Ymir. By severing Eren's head, Mikasa not only stops the Rumbling but also ends the existence of the Founding Titan and, by extension, the Titan power itself. This act is not one of vengeance, but of profound sacrifice and love, a twisted culmination of her lifelong bond with Eren. It’s a moment that is both heartbreaking and triumphant, a powerful testament to Mikasa's strength and her capacity for love, even in the face of unimaginable loss. The Letzter Moment der Titan is not just the death of Eren; it's the death of the Titan curse that has plagued Eldians for generations. It signifies a new beginning, a chance for the world to rebuild and perhaps find peace, free from the monstrous threat of Titans. However, the cost of this peace is immense, and the scars of the Rumbling will forever remain. The series doesn't shy away from the consequences of these actions. The world is forever changed, and the survivors are left to deal with the trauma and the responsibility of rebuilding. The Letzter Moment der Titan leaves us with a sense of closure, but also with lingering questions about whether true peace can ever be achieved after such widespread devastation. The Aftermath and a Fragile Peace

Following the Letzter Moment der Titan, the world is left in ruins, but also with a newfound, albeit fragile, peace. The eradication of the Titan curse and the cessation of the Rumbling bring an end to centuries of conflict and fear. However, the Letzter Moment der Titan doesn't magically erase the pain, the loss, or the trauma that so many characters have endured. The survivors, including Mikasa, Armin, Jean, Connie, and Levi, are left to grapple with the immense cost of their victory. The world outside Paradis Island has been decimated, and the people of Paradis must now face the daunting task of rebuilding and forging new relationships with the surviving nations. The Letzter Moment der Titan opens up a complex future, one where the cycle of hatred has been broken, but the scars of war remain deeply ingrained. Armin, now the de facto leader, takes on the monumental task of negotiating peace and trying to foster understanding between the former enemies. His intelligence and compassion are put to the ultimate test as he tries to guide humanity towards a brighter future. The Letzter Moment der Titan is followed by a long period of rebuilding and reconciliation. While the Titan threat is gone, the underlying issues of prejudice, nationalism, and the lust for power still linger. The series concludes with a poignant epilogue that hints at the cyclical nature of history, suggesting that while humanity may have learned from its mistakes, the potential for conflict always remains.
